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between Alpaca and Moco?

To start, connect both your Alpaca and Moco acc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in Alpaca triggers actions in Moco (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from Alpaca is recorded in Moco?

Absolutely. You can customize how Alpaca data is recorded in Moco. This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of Moco, set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between Alpaca and Moco?

The data sync between Alpaca and Moco typ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from Alpaca to Moco?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between Alpaca and Moco?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between Alpaca and Moco. For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About Alpaca

Alpaca is a platform that provides commission-free trading APIs for stocks and other financial instruments. It allows developers to build and automate their trading strategies with ease.

About Moco

MOCO (MObile COmpany) is a lean cloud software made for small medium-sized agency and service businesses. Including time tracking, billing, resource planning, sales-funnel and CRM.
